A photo I took in the rain yesterday.

The only changes I made:

Cropped
Slightly reduced in size
White balance corrected
Unsharp mask

I probably need to throw that background more out of focus.

Canon 6D; 16-35mm lens, Photoshop CS5.

The only other thing I have to say is that I compared my correction of the white balance to Photoshop's auto-levels. The Levels had a green cast. At first it looked better, then I realized it wasn't. At least, I don't think so. :-)
